Warning Signs Your Cover Needs Repair

If you notice any of the following, contact us for a diagnostic assessment before the issue escalates.

Cover stops mid-travel or reverses unexpectedly

Likely cause: Limit switch fault, track obstruction, or motor overload

Grinding, clicking, or unusual motor sounds

Likely cause: Worn gearbox, dry bearings, or misaligned track

Cover no longer sits flush when closed

Likely cause: Rope stretch, slat warping, or track misalignment

Water pooling on top of the cover

Likely cause: Drainage blockage, fabric sag, or pump failure

Visible fabric tears, slat cracks, or UV damage

Likely cause: Material fatigue — replacement slats or fabric panels needed

Key switch or remote unresponsive

Likely cause: Electrical fault, receiver issue, or battery failure
